Every licensee must also pay a yearly licensing fee. A small family childcare home's annual licensing fee is $73. A large family childcare home's annual licensing fee is $140. A childcare center's annual licensing fee is equal to one-half of the application fee.

Fees associated with opening and operating these facilities typically include licensing fees, application fees, annual renewal fees, and potential inspection fees. Additionally, there may be costs related to facilities maintenance, insurance, and compliance with health and safety regulations.
Individuals or organizations seeking to establish and operate Family Child Care Homes, Large Family Child Care Homes, and Early Care and Education and School Age Centers are required to file these fees. This includes child care providers who wish to be licensed and compliant with local regulations.
To fill out the fees related to these operations, applicants should complete the appropriate forms provided by their local licensing authority. This includes detailing their facility type, the number of children served, and any required documentation, along with payment of the specified fees.
The purpose of these fees is to cover the administrative costs of the licensing process, ensure compliance with health and safety regulations, provide oversight of child care facilities, and support ongoing training and resources for providers.
Applicants must report information including the type of child care service being provided, the proposed capacity of the facility, the location, and details about the staff qualifications. It may also require financial information related to the fees being paid.
